A WITHDRAWAL.

t./LETTER BY REV. A. CAMERON. (BT TEI-EGEAPn.—SI'ECIAt. CORRKSPO3 DENT.) Duncdin, October 8. The Rev. A. Cameron writes to the eventing paper on Wednesday as follows:— !' Kindly fallow mo space for a few lines in connection with yesterday's meeting of the Dtinedin Presbytery and Mr. Sutherland's charges!, of wire-pulling. I feel that only harm can come from mombers of the Presbytery hurling names at ono another, and in this respent I have erred grievously in describing Mr. Sutherland's conduct as that of a'coward. Mr. Sutherland is no coward. AYhrit scaled his lips and prevented him from saying openly in Presbytery what lie has been saying of mo in private, I do not know. At next meeting of Presbytery I shall withdraw this offensive expression, and apologise to Mr. Sutherland for my hasty and ill-ad- , vised words. As the words I withdraw have appeared in your columns, I think it right not to wait for the meeting of Presbytery before withdrawing and apologising, but to do so in this public manner and at the earliest opportunity,"-
